Types of Coverage Offered by Lemonade Car Insurance

Lemonade Car Insurance may offer several common types of auto insurance coverage.


1. Liability Insurance

Liability insurance helps cover injuries and property damage caused to others if the policyholder is responsible for an accident.

This coverage generally includes:

  • Bodily injury liability

  • Property damage liability

Liability insurance is legally required in most states.


2. Collision Coverage

Collision insurance helps pay for repairs to the insured vehicle after accidents involving:

  • Other vehicles

  • Road barriers

  • Objects

  • Rollovers

Coverage limits and deductibles vary by policy.


3. Comprehensive Coverage

Comprehensive insurance protects against non-collision risks such as:

  • Theft

  • Fire

  • Storm damage

  • Flooding

  • Falling objects

  • Vandalism

Comprehensive coverage is especially valuable for newer vehicles.


4. Uninsured and Underinsured Motorist Coverage

This coverage helps protect drivers if they are involved in accidents with drivers who have insufficient or no insurance.

Medical expenses and vehicle repairs may be partially covered depending on policy terms.


5. Medical Payments Coverage

Medical payments coverage may help pay healthcare expenses for drivers and passengers after accidents.


6. Personal Injury Protection (PIP)

In certain states, PIP coverage may help pay for:

  • Medical bills

  • Lost wages

  • Rehabilitation expenses

Availability depends on local insurance regulations.


7. Roadside Assistance

Some policies may offer optional roadside services such as:

  • Towing

  • Battery assistance

  • Fuel delivery

  • Flat tire support

  • Lockout services

Factors Affecting Lemonade Car Insurance Premiums

Several factors influence auto insurance pricing.


Age

Younger drivers often pay higher premiums because of increased accident risk.


Driving Record

Traffic violations, accidents, and previous claims affect rates.


Vehicle Type

Luxury and sports vehicles generally cost more to insure.


Location

Insurance prices vary based on local accident rates, weather risks, and crime levels.


Coverage Amount

Higher coverage limits typically increase premium costs.


Deductible Amount

Higher deductibles may reduce monthly premiums.


Mileage

Frequent driving may increase insurance costs.


Credit-Based Insurance Information

In some states, insurers may consider credit-related information when determining premiums.
